Does anyone know of an Android keyboard app that isn't spyware, which contains emojis that override the emojis originally included with a version of the OS?

I've been testing Android phones, with both Nougat and Marshmallow installed and I'm finding the emojis from the Nougat phone are successfully seen with third party apps and am testing against Geary, yet some of the Marshmallow emojis aren't. An occasional emoji from Marshmallow might make it through successfully, but others will display random junk characters instead, as if they're not being recognized. Both phones have the new Google Messages app installed and Gboard (Google keyboard). Some of the Marshmallow emojis are of a different design vs Nougat and I'm seeing this same different design whether I use the factory installed messaging app, Google Messages or Gboard. 

I am aware that there is now an emoji standard, which may have been released after Marshmallow, but Marshmallow is using a version of Unicode. Not sure if Nougat is as well, or if this is actually the problem (Unicode not being recognized).
